[SHOT 2024] Longshot Cameras Announces Affordable Range Target System

At the SHOT Show 2024, Longshot Cameras unveiled the Ranger, a new target camera system designed for shooters looking to enhance their practice sessions. The 100-yard range compact camera is engineered to provide shooters with the ability to see their shots in real time without the need to change positions.

The Ranger is equipped with advanced 5G WiFi technology, which allows for a seamless connection to a phone or tablet. This turns the mobile device into a live feed monitor, providing users with immediate visual feedback on their accuracy and shot placement. The camera boasts a 2-megapixel picture quality, ensuring that details are captured clearly, even at significant distances.

Adding value to the Ranger is its compatibility with the Longshot app, which offers a suite of tools and features to improve the shooting experience. Users can track their performance, log data and analyze their sessions all within the app’s interface.

For shooters who require an extended range, Longshot Cameras also introduced the Ranger+ as part of their new offerings. This enhanced version of the Ranger extends the clarity of shot visualization up to 1000 yards. Product Specs
– 5G WiFi technology for fast and reliable connection.
– 2MP picture quality for clear image capture.
– Compatible with the Longshot app to utilize various shooting enhancement features.
– Ranger+ available for long-range shooting, offering visibility up to 1000 yards.
– Ranger MSRP is $199.
– Ranger+ MSRP is $399.
